Course structure

• Foundations of Data-Driven Innovation
• Data Collection and Preprocessing Techniques
• Machine Learning for Engineering Applications
• Data Visualization and Communication
• Big Data Analytics and Cloud Computing
• Predictive Modeling and Optimization
• Ethical Considerations in Data-Driven Engineering
• Real-World Case Studies in Engineering Innovation
• Tools and Technologies for Data-Driven Decision Making
• Capstone Project: Applying Data-Driven Solutions in Engineering

Career path

Data Engineer

Design and maintain scalable data pipelines, ensuring efficient data processing and storage for engineering projects.

Machine Learning Engineer

Develop and deploy machine learning models to optimize engineering processes and drive innovation.

AI Solutions Architect

Design AI-driven systems and frameworks to solve complex engineering challenges.

Business Intelligence Analyst

Analyze engineering data to provide actionable insights and support data-driven decision-making.
